- Hybrid girder structure having truss and tension cable
The present invention relates to a girder having a truss cable composite structure. The girder comprises: a first steel pipe (22) having both ends being individually coupled to an upper front part of a first and a third installation end (12, 16), and a second steel pipe (26) having both ends individually being coupled to the upper front parts of the second and fourth installation ends (14, 18); a side truss member including a plurality of first inclined materials (32) individually having V-shaped structures with upper ends fixated and coupled to the first steel pipe (22), a plurality of second inclined materials (36) individually made of V-shaped structures with upper ends fixated and coupled to the second steel pipe (26), and a connection member (34) having both ends fixated and coupled to the first and second inclined materials (32, 36); an upper truss member which includes first and second vertical members (42, 46) and a horizontal member (44) to be fixated and coupled to the upper surface of the connection member (34); and a cable member arranged on the individual lower ends of the first and second inclined members (32, 36).
